We’ve had the ability to provide ticked based history for a number of years, but have never been able to display the ticked information in the charts part of the program. However, a change that was made a few weeks ago to the chart, to fix a problem in a particular area, meant that it was then possible to include a ticked time span in the charts.
Therefore, the next release of the program will include the ability to show ticked based charts. It’s not yet implemented, but by the time of the next release, it should also be possible to have a ticked chart show with groupings based on the number of ticks. For example, display a chart where each bar, on an OHLC chart, represents 100 ticks. No matter whether those trades occurred over the course of one minute, five hours (i.e. Slow Night Sessions) or five days.

What’s a tick? A tick is a trade. So a ticked chart of Microsoft would show one point (or one bar) for every trade on Microsoft. Because of this, ticked charts will not be available for delayed data.
